About 61 Ashton Gardens

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

61 Ashton Gardens is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Romford (RM6 6RT). It has a recorded floor area of 107 m² (around 1152 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(November 2022) shows an E (score 47),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 75), a 2-band jump.

2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, a garage conversion and new windows,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 76% of similar EPCs). Across 1999–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.2%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£447/sq ft) was about 79.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old April 2023 for £515,000.
